Oracle OMS概述
Oracle Management Service(OMS)是Oracle数据库管理系统中一个至关重要的组件,它负责监控和管理Oracle数据库实例。OMS提供了丰富的工具和功能,使得数据库管理员(DBA)能够实时监控数据库的性能,及时发现问题并进行调整。然而,近期许多用户和DBA报告称,他们的Oracle OMS的内存使用量不断上升,这成为了他们关注的焦点。
OMS内存使用量上升的原因
OMS内存使用量不断上升的原因可能有多种,以下是一些常见的原因:
配置不当:OMS的配置参数可能设置不当,导致内存消耗增加。例如,JVM参数设置过高,或者某些内存池的大小配置过大。
监控数据量过大:随着监控的数据量不断增加,OMS需要处理更多的数据,这可能导致内存消耗增加。
异常数据或错误:OMS可能接收到异常数据或错误信息,导致内存消耗增加,甚至可能引发内存泄漏。
第三方插件或应用程序:某些第三方插件或应用程序可能与OMS冲突,导致内存使用量增加。
诊断和解决OMS内存使用量上升的策略
为了有效地解决OMS内存使用量上升的问题,以下是一些诊断和解决策略:
审查OMS配置:检查OMS的配置参数,确保它们设置得当。特别是JVM参数和内存池大小,需要根据实际情况进行调整。
监控监控数据量:定期检查OMS收集的监控数据量,如果数据量过大,考虑优化监控策略,减少不必要的监控项。
检查异常数据和错误:分析OMS日志,查找可能引起内存泄漏的异常数据或错误信息,并采取措施解决这些问题。
更新和修复第三方插件:确保所有第三方插件和应用程序都是最新版本,并且没有与OMS冲突的问题。
增加硬件资源:如果内存使用量持续上升,且无法通过配置调整解决,可能需要考虑增加硬件资源,如增加物理内存。
预防措施
为了避免OMS内存使用量上升的问题,以下是一些预防措施:
定期审查配置:定期审查OMS的配置参数,确保它们仍然适用于当前的环境。
优化监控策略:根据实际需求,优化监控策略,避免监控过多不必要的数据。
及时更新和修复:确保所有第三方插件和应用程序都是最新版本,并及时修复已知的问题。
监控内存使用情况:定期监控OMS的内存使用情况,以便及时发现潜在问题。
结论
Oracle OMS内存使用量不断上升是一个需要DBA密切关注的问题。通过了解原因、采取有效的诊断和解决策略,以及实施预防措施,可以有效地控制OMS的内存使用量,确保数据库的稳定运行。DBA应该定期检查OMS的性能,并在必要时进行调整,以保持数据库的优化状态。
转载请注明来自深圳市艾瑞比智能有限公司,本文标题:《oracle oms不断上升,oracle smart update 》
还没有评论,来说两句吧...